¿Dónde ver Yal Plebeyo?
Algunos de los mejores lugares para observar Yal Plebeyo en libertad son Reserva Nacional las Vicuñas (Chile), Los Cardones National Park (Argentina) y Lauca National Park (Chile) — entre 7 hotspots de fauna en Chile, Argentina, Perú y Ecuador.
